Justin Duzik: Good job to Moffat County schools
To the editor:
Good job to Moffat County schools. I read in the Craig Daily Press about your open-minded, purely informational stance on the intelligent design theory.
While teaching state-mandated information on evolution, you also tell students about other ideas (intelligent design) and where to go to learn more details about them. At this time, this is the best we can do.
Good job also to the Craig Daily Press for presenting positive information in a neutral view. Media plays a big part in how we look at different situations around the world and right here at home. I wish other organizations, mainly ones involving getting information to people, kept their opinions to themselves and just presented the true facts.
Thank you to all people who keep an open mind and actually personally research both sides of an issue before taking a particular view of that issue.
This is so important, especially with most of the media coverage today being biased.
Justin Duzik
